This is the number of frames in which the transmission process experienced no collisions.
This is the number of frames in which the transmission process experienced one collision.
This is the number of frames in which the transmission process experienced two to fifteen
collisions.
This is the number of good unicast frames transmitted.
This is the number of good broadcast frames transmitted.
This is the number of good multicast frames transmitted.
This is the number of 802.3x pause frames transmitted.
This is the number of good frames that were flooded, i.e., sent to every port, by the switch
due to unknown destinations.
This is the number of good frames that were filtered by the switch.
This is the number of packets the switch discarded due to full memory.
This is the number of broadcast packets discarded by the switch.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) received that were 64 octets in
length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) received that were between 65 and
127 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) received that were between 128 and
255 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) received that were between 256 and
511 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) received that were between 512 and
1023 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) received that were between 1024 and
above in length.
This is the number of times in which the transmission fails due to excessive collisions.
This is the number of times a collision is detected later than 512 bit time into the frame
transmission.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) transmitted that were 64 octets in
length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) transmitted that were between 65
and 127 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) transmitted that were between 128
and 255 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) transmitted that were between 256
and 511 octets in length.
This is the number of frames (including bad frames) transmitted that were between 512
and 1023 octets in length.
